LavenderSs
帖子: 1
注册时间: 2016-05-11 17:04

求助:如何实现将图像从RGB48转YUV422?

我现在需要将RGB48的图像转为YUV422,在网上看了很多算法,都是实现了从RGB24转YUV420/422的,例如,http://blog.csdn.net/xgmiao/article/det ... 。我套用了该转换方法,但转换后的结果是错误的。
我在网上查到的有关RGB转YUV的公式是这样的:
Y’ = 0.257*R' + 0.504*G' + 0.098*B' + 16
Cb' = -0.148*R' - 0.291*G' + 0.439*B' + 128
Cr' = 0.439*R' - 0.368*G' - 0.071*B' + 128
该公式使用的前提是一个RGB像素占3字节(R、G、B各占1字节),而RGB48是占6字节(R、G、B各占2字节),个人感觉不能直接套用这个公式了。

请问各位有谁知道到底应该如何转换RGB48的图片?
多谢了!!!

回到 “理论讨论 / Theoratical discussion”